Your California Privacy Rights

  • Right to Know: Request disclosure of personal information collected, used, or shared
  • Right to Delete: Request deletion of personal information we have collected
  • Right to Correct: Request correction of inaccurate personal information
  • Right to Opt-Out: Opt out of the sale or sharing of personal information
  • Right to Limit Use: Limit use of sensitive personal information
  • Right to Non-Discrimination: Exercise your rights without discriminatory treatment
